Advertisement

使用 EXCEL VBA 清除重复数据

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本教程详细介绍了如何利用Excel VBA编写宏来高效清除工作表中的重复数据记录,适合中级用户学习。 在Excel VBA中实现删除重复数据的功能可以通过编写宏来完成。这种方法能够帮助用户高效地清理工作表中的重复记录,提高数据分析的效率。要创建这样的宏,首先需要打开VBA编辑器,在其中插入一个新的模块,并输入相应的代码以识别并移除指定列或整个表格内的重复项。通过设置合适的条件和参数,可以灵活应对不同的数据处理需求。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• 使 EXCEL VBA
    优质
    本教程详细介绍了如何利用Excel VBA编写宏来高效清除工作表中的重复数据记录,适合中级用户学习。 在Excel VBA中实现删除重复数据的功能可以通过编写宏来完成。这种方法能够帮助用户高效地清理工作表中的重复记录,提高数据分析的效率。要创建这样的宏,首先需要打开VBA编辑器,在其中插入一个新的模块,并输入相应的代码以识别并移除指定列或整个表格内的重复项。通过设置合适的条件和参数,可以灵活应对不同的数据处理需求。
  • 使VBAExcel的密码保护
    优质
    本教程详细介绍了如何运用VBA编程技巧来解除Microsoft Excel工作簿或工作表的密码保护,帮助用户轻松访问受保护的数据。 利用OFFICE内置的VBA功能来破解EXCEL中的密码保护是一种可能的方法。不过需要注意的是,这种做法可能会违反软件使用条款或相关法律法规,请谨慎处理,并确保在合法合规的前提下进行操作。同时,在尝试任何技术手段前,建议先确认是否有其他更安全、正规的方式来解决遇到的问题,比如联系文件的原始创建者获取正确的访问权限或者密码等途径。
  • 如何使pandas删中的
    优质
    本篇文章将详细介绍如何利用Pandas库来识别和删除数据集中的重复记录,帮助用户掌握高效的数据清洗技巧。 在进行数据分析的过程中,我们经常会遇到数据重复的问题。有些重复的数据是我们需要保留的,而另一些则可能会影响后续分析的结果准确性。因此,在开始正式分析之前,了解如何去除不需要的重复值是非常重要的。 首先通过pandas库读取一个名为“planets.csv”的文件: ```python import pandas as pd planets = pd.read_csv(planets.csv) ``` 然后我们可以通过以下命令来查看数据集前10行的内容: ```python print(planets.head(10)) ``` 为了去除重复值,我们可以使用pandas的`drop_duplicates()`函数。这里以方法(method)和年份(year)这两列作为判断依据,并且只保留第一次出现的数据(即keep=first): ```python planets.drop_duplicates(subset=[method, year], keep=first, inplace=True) ``` 最后,再次打印数据集的前10行以查看变化: ```python print(planets.head(10)) ``` 这样就可以有效地去除不需要的数据重复项。
  • Excel工作表密码(使VBA宏)
    优质
    本教程介绍如何通过编写VBA宏来解除Excel中工作表的保护密码,无需原始密码,适用于忘记密码或需要批量解密的情况。 用于解除OFFICE中Excel电子表格的VBA加密密码,方便、简单且易于使用。
  • 在Word中使VBA插入Excel
    优质
    本教程介绍如何利用VBA(Visual Basic for Applications)编写宏程序,在Microsoft Word文档中自动插入来自Excel的数据,提升办公效率。 主要用于在WORD文档中实现数据的动态变化,并能自动更新数据。
  • EXCEL中的
    优质
    本教程详细介绍了如何在Excel中识别和删除重复数据的方法,帮助用户高效清理工作表中的冗余信息。 这个小工具虽然不够成熟,但可以方便地去除大数据中的重复号码。
  • SQL Server 删
    优质
    本教程介绍如何在SQL Server中高效地识别和删除数据库表中的重复记录,包括使用SQL查询语句和技术来保持数据完整性。 在处理重复记录时有两种情况:一种是完全重复的记录,即所有字段都相同;另一种是部分关键字段重复的记录,例如Name字段重复,而其他字段可以不同或全部相同并可忽略。
  • 使VBAExcel中连接Oracle
    优质
    本教程介绍如何利用VBA编程技术,在Excel环境中实现与Oracle数据库的数据交互和管理,适合需要自动化数据处理的专业人士学习。 使用Excel通过VBA连接Oracle数据库查询数据可以实现一键自动快速生成所需的多个标准报表,从而大大提高工作效率并节省大量时间。
  • 使Excel VBA上传至SQL Server
    优质
    本教程介绍如何利用Excel VBA编写代码,实现从电子表格高效地将数据导入到SQL Server数据库中,适用于需要自动化办公流程的专业人士。 在企业信息化初期,大部分数据通过Excel进行管理。作为IT人员,对Excel既爱又恨:爱其灵活易用性,但同时也痛恨它无法实现统一的数据管理。为了将Excel中的数据集中到数据库中,一个常见的方法就是直接存入数据库。然而,导入和填报这些过程如果完全由IT人员来完成,则会非常耗时且效率低下。 开发自定义页面或购买第三方工具是两种解决方案,但前者需要编程技能(谁又会在寻求这种方案的同时去搜索代码呢),而后者则受限于预算问题。因此,使用Excel的VBA宏成为了另一种选择。尽管看起来简单,实际上利用VBA实现数据上传和调取数据库内容的操作却会耗费大量时间和效率较低。 这里提供一种资源分享:通过编写一段简单的Excel VBA脚本,可以将当前工作表中的所有信息直接上传至数据库,并且能够从数据库中获取所需的数据进行展示。
  • 使 pandas 去新生成表格的方法
    优质
    本教程介绍如何利用Pandas库高效地识别和删除DataFrame中的重复记录,并展示如何对清洗后的数据进行格式化输出或保存。 在使用Python处理数据时,DataFrame和set是常用的工具。以下是一个示例代码: ```python import pandas as pd # 读取CSV文件 train = pd.read_csv(XXX.csv) # 选择需要去重的列 train = train[item_id] # 使用set进行去重操作 train = set(train) # 因为set是无序的,所以需要用list转换后才能创建DataFrame对象 data = pd.DataFrame(list(train), columns=[item_id]) # 将处理后的数据保存到新的CSV文件中 data.to_csv(xxx.csv, index=False) ``` 以上代码展示了如何使用pandas库实现去重操作,并将结果重新存储为表格。